Как изменить «несохраненный» цвет на открытой вкладке документа Geany?

Мне не удалось найти место, чтобы изменить цвет, который я выделил на опубликованном изображении. Это не в установленной теме Geany. Я думаю, что это связано с темой Ubuntu, но я не смог найти его. Он настолько мал, что я получаю противоречивые результаты, когда использую GIMP для извлечения цвета из него. Я не могу найти точный шестнадцатеричный код цвета, чтобы помочь в моем поиске.

цвет, который я хочу изменить

моя тема Ubuntu находится в

/usr/share/themes/Ambiance-Blackout-XFCE-LXDE-Manila

в этом каталоге ...

/ usr / share / themes / Ambiance-Blackout-XFCE-LXDE-Manila

Кто-нибудь знает или имеет идею файл, в котором я могу найти цвет?

2
задан 7 April 2016 в 07:26

3 ответа

Если Вы хотите изменить цвет текста на "несохраненной" вкладке, которая, кажется, "startup.sh", Вы не должны знать цвет текущего текста.

Geany является все еще gtk2 приложением. Ваша домашняя папка должна иметь скрытый файл, названный .gtkrc-2.0. Откройте его и проверка, если это имеет строку как это:

include "/home/your_login_name/.gtkrc-2.0.mine"

, Если это делает, просто закройтесь ~/.gtkrc-2.0. Если это не делает, добавьте строка в самом конце, удостоверяясь использование корректного полного пути. Сохраните и выйдите.

, Если у Вас нет файла названным ~/.gtkrc-2.0, откройте терминал, удостоверьтесь, что Вы находитесь в своей домашней папке и работаете

echo "include \"/home/your_login_name/.gtkrc-2.0.mine\"" > .gtkrc-2.0

, Но удостоверяетесь, что изменяетесь your_login_name на то, что является соответствующим.

Теперь, посмотрите, есть ли у Вас также скрытый файл, названный ~/.gtkrc-2.0.mine. Если у Вас нет файла, просто создайте его с помощью плоскость текстовый редактор. Если это уже существует, создайте резервную копию его для безопасности и затем добавьте следующие строки:

# CUSTOM STYLES

# *******GEANY*******
#Styling text (fg) in Geany's tabs
#Note that styling bg is done in the theme's gtkrc, not here, because we want that effect across other programs with tabs as well
# document status colors
style "geany-document-status-changed-style" {
    fg[NORMAL] = "magenta" #tab text when changes are made but not saved and tab is active
    fg[ACTIVE] = "#ff0746" #tab text when changes are made but not saved and tab is not in focus
}
widget "*.geany-document-status-changed" 
style "geany-document-status-changed-style"
# font style and size in Geany's tabs
style "geany" = "geany-tabs" {
    font_name = "Ubuntu Mono 14"
}
widget "GeanyMainWindow.GtkVBox.GtkVPaned.GtkHPaned.GtkNotebook.*" 
style "geany" 

я также включал код, чтобы позволить Вам указывать шрифт только для UI Geany. Можно удалить или прокомментировать те строки!

Сохранили отредактированный файл (как простой текст). Закройте все экземпляры Geany. Затем откройте Geany и проверьте эффект того, что Вы сделали. Очевидно, Вы захотите цвета, подходящие для Вашего вкуса.

Вот то, что я вижу.

Geany tab text

Все самое лучшее.

0
ответ дан 7 April 2016 в 17:26
  • 1
    У Вас также будет намного лучшая удача с WPA2-AES и не TKIP. – chili555 16 August 2017 в 08:07

Сжатие @tk-bose's решения минимума операции в секунду... (только для convencience)

$> cd ~
$> cat .gtkrc (-<tab>, <tab>... nope, file does not exist..)

Thus let's continue with:
$> echo "include \"/home/(YOUR USERNAME)/.gtkrc-2.0.mine\"" > .gtkrc-2.0      

$> cat .gtkrc-2.0       (just to verify)
include "/home/(YOUR USERNAME)/.gtkrc-2.0.mine"

put in the content show below:
$> pluma .gtkrc-2.0.mine    ( plume or nano or vi or any other editor)

Я взял более умеренные красные (предполагающий, что этот красный рев был, что OP нарушил, как я). И почти идентичные для focus/non-focus (учитывая, что сохраненные вкладки являются также всегда белыми, активными или не):

# GEANNY custom styles - taken from askubuntu.com/q/754645

style "geany-document-status-changed-style" {
    fg[NORMAL] = "#ff4d4d" #unsaved tab active (aka in focus)
    fg[ACTIVE] = "#dd3d3d" #unsaved tab not active
}
widget "*.geany-document-status-changed" 
style "geany-document-status-changed-style"
0
ответ дан 7 April 2016 в 17:26
  • 1
    Я попробовал это, но кажусь не работой, когда я попробовал ' timedatectl | grep local' это сказало ** RTC в локальном TZ: да Предупреждающий: система настроена для чтения времени RTC в зоне местного времени. ' локальный RTC набора timedatectl 0'. ** – Michael 25 August 2017 в 01:24

Два приведенных выше решения не помогли мне. Это мое решение:

  1. Закройте Geany.
  2. Откройте терминал.
  3. Откройте документ geany.css как root в редакторе (например, Bluefish) следующим образом:

     sudo bluefish /usr/share/geany/geany.css
    
  4. Введите пароль; Входить.

  5. Искать: статус изменен .
  6. В строке ниже вы можете изменить цвет.
  7. Сохраните документ.
  8. Закройте Bluefish.
0
ответ дан 19 January 2020 в 16:40

Другие вопросы по тегам:

Похожие вопросы: